Converteer VDX-bestanden naar TEX met GroupDocs voor .NET

Invoering

Het converteren van Microsoft Visio XML Drawing (VDX)-bestanden naar LaTeX (TEX)-formaat is een veelvoorkomende vereiste voor ontwikkelaars die diverse documentformaten integreren. Deze uitgebreide handleiding begeleidt u bij het gebruik ervan. GroupDocs.Conversion voor .NET om VDX-bestanden (.vdx) naadloos te converteren naar TEX-formaat (.tex).

Aan het einde van deze tutorial leert u het volgende:

  • GroupDocs.Conversion voor .NET installeren en installeren
  • Converteer VDX-bestanden naar TEX met C#-code
  • Optimaliseer conversieprestaties
  • Integratie met andere .NET-frameworks

Laten we beginnen met het instellen van uw omgeving en het transformeren van documentindelingen.

Vereisten

Zorg ervoor dat u het volgende bij de hand hebt voordat u begint:

Vereiste bibliotheken en versies

  • GroupDocs.Conversion voor .NET (Versie 25.3.0)
  • Basiskennis van C#-programmering
  • Visual Studio of een andere IDE die .NET-ontwikkeling ondersteunt

Vereisten voor omgevingsinstellingen

Zorg ervoor dat uw ontwikkelomgeving up-to-date is om compatibiliteitsproblemen te voorkomen.

GroupDocs.Conversion instellen voor .NET

Om te beginnen, installeer je GroupDocs.Conversion. Zo doe je dat:

NuGet-pakketbeheerconsole

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

Licentieverwerving

Begin met een gratis proefperiode om de functies van GroupDocs.Conversion te ontdekken:

Voor volledige toegang kunt u overwegen een licentie aan te schaffen via GroupDocs-aankoop.

Basisinitialisatie en -installatie

Nadat u de bibliotheek hebt geïnstalleerd, initialiseert u deze met de volgende regels C#-code:

using GroupDocs.Conversion;

Deze naamruimte biedt toegang tot conversiefunctionaliteiten.

Implementatiegids

Nu alles is ingesteld, kunnen we de VDX naar TEX-conversiefunctie implementeren.

Converteer VDX-bestand naar TEX-formaat

Overzicht

In deze sectie wordt uitgelegd hoe u een Microsoft Visio XML-tekeningbestand converteert naar LaTeX-formaat met behulp van GroupDocs.Conversion. Deze mogelijkheid is handig voor ontwikkelaars die deze documentformaten integreren in .NET-applicaties.

Stapsgewijze handleiding

Paden definiëren en bron-VDX-bestand laden

Begin met het definiëren van de invoer- en uitvoerpaden:

string inputF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.vdx");
string outputFolder = Path.Combine("YOUR_OUTPUT_DIRECTORY");
string outputFile = Path.Combine(outputFolder, "vdx-converted-to.tex");

// Laad het bron-VDX-bestand met GroupDocs.Conversion
using (var converter = new GroupDocs.Conversion.Converter(inputFilePath))
{
    // Conversielogica komt hier
}
Conversieopties instellen

Stel conversieopties in om het doelformaat te specificeren:

PageDescriptionLanguageConvertOptions options = new PageDescriptionLanguageConvertOptions
{
    Format = GroupDocs.Conversion.FileTypes.PageDescriptionLanguageFileType.Tex
};

De options object configureert het conversieproces en specificeert TEX als uitvoerformaat.

Conversie uitvoeren

Voer de conversie uit en sla het uitvoerbestand op:

converter.Convert(outputFile, options);

Dit fragment verzorgt het daadwerkelijke conversieproces en zet VDX-bestanden naadloos om in TEX-formaat.

Tips voor probleemoplossing

  • Ontbrekende bestanden: Zorg ervoor dat de invoerpaden correct zijn.
  • Versieconflicten: Controleer de compatibiliteit tussen .NET- en GroupDocs.Conversion-versies.

Praktische toepassingen

Het converteren van VDX naar TEX is voordelig in scenario’s zoals:

  1. Academische projecten: Studenten die Visio-diagrammen omzetten in LaTeX-documenten voor scripties.
  2. Technische documentatie:Ingenieurs die complexe diagrammen integreren in technische rapporten.
  3. Uitgeven: Uitgevers die ontwerpelementen uit Visio-bestanden opnemen in opgemaakte documenten.

Deze voorbeelden illustreren hoe veelzijdig dit conversieproces in verschillende sectoren kan zijn.

Prestatieoverwegingen

Voor optimale prestaties tijdens conversies:

  • Resourcegebruik: Controleer het geheugen- en CPU-gebruik, vooral bij grote bestanden.
  • Beste praktijken: Gebruik asynchrone methoden om de responsiviteit van UI-applicaties te verbeteren.

Door deze richtlijnen te volgen, verbetert u de efficiëntie van uw documentconversieprocessen.

Conclusie

In deze tutorial hebben we het converteren van VDX-bestanden naar TEX-formaat besproken met behulp van GroupDocs.Conversion voor .NET. Je hebt geleerd hoe je je omgeving instelt, de conversiefunctie implementeert en deze toepast in praktijksituaties. Overweeg als volgende stap om de aanvullende functies van GroupDocs.Conversion te verkennen.

Klaar om te beginnen met converteren? Implementeer deze oplossing vandaag nog in uw projecten!

FAQ-sectie

1. Wat is GroupDocs.Conversion voor .NET? GroupDocs.Conversion voor .NET is een bibliotheek waarmee ontwikkelaars verschillende documentindelingen binnen toepassingen kunnen converteren.

2. Kan ik andere bestandstypen converteren met GroupDocs.Conversion? Ja, het ondersteunt een breed scala aan documentformaten naast VDX en TEX.

3. Hoe ga ik om met fouten tijdens de conversie? Implementeer try-catch-blokken rondom uw conversielogica om uitzonderingen effectief te beheren.

4. Wat zijn de systeemvereisten voor GroupDocs.Conversion? Zorg ervoor dat .NET Framework 4.6.1 of hoger op uw computer is geïnstalleerd.

5. Is er ondersteuning beschikbaar als ik problemen ondervind? Ja, bezoek GroupDocs-ondersteuningsforum voor hulp.

Bronnen

Voor meer informatie en bronnen:

Door deze handleiding te volgen, bent u goed toegerust om VDX naar TEX-conversies uit te voeren in uw .NET-applicaties. Veel plezier met coderen!